Spring Valley lost against Colfax back in April,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Monday. The Cardinals fell just short of the Vikings by a score of 5-4.
Spring Valley sa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Kate Cipriano, who went 2-for-3 with two runs. Zoe Larson also deserves some recognition as she brought in her first RBI of the season.
Spring Valley dropped their record down to 2-10 with the defeat, which was their tenth straight on the road dating back to last season. As for Colfax, the victory was the sixth in a row for them, bringing their record up to 9-4.
